Another thing I hope to see in ME:A is faster weapon transitions. You know something is wrong when reloading the primary is faster than switching to secondary. Kind of makes carrying a secondary obsolete unless it's a specific purpose weapon like an acolyte for shields, some ULM SMG for Guardians, a Scorpion for Phantoms etc..

Agreed. I also liked the greater use of differing defense multipliers for weapon classes from ME2. One gun setups shouldn't be so much more effective on weapon kits like most soldiers and infiltrators are. Being forced to use the right tool for the job is fun, but only if the time you gain by using the correct weapon for the defense makes up for the time it took to switch to said weapon.
